Unix开发环境高效搭建与系统性能调优策略

在Unix开发环境中,高效搭建是提升开发效率的关键。选择合适的操作系统版本,如Linux发行版或macOS,能够为后续开发提供稳定的基础。安装必要的工具链,包括编译器、调试器和版本控制工具,可以显著减少配置时间。

系统性能调优需要从多个层面入手。内核参数的调整,例如文件描述符限制和网络栈优化,能够提升系统处理能力。同时,合理配置内存和CPU资源,避免资源争用,有助于提高程序运行效率。

使用高效的包管理工具可以简化依赖管理和软件安装流程。例如,apt、yum或Homebrew等工具能够自动解决依赖关系,减少手动干预带来的错误风险。

日志监控与分析是调优的重要环节。通过集中化日志管理工具,如syslog或ELK堆栈,可以快速定位系统瓶颈和潜在问题,为性能优化提供数据支持。

AI绘图结果,仅供参考

定期进行系统健康检查,包括磁盘空间、进程状态和网络连接,有助于预防性能下降。结合自动化脚本实现定期维护,能够保持系统的长期稳定运行。

dawei

【声明】:九江站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复